Distracted driving is the most common cause of road accidents in the United States, resulting in more crashes every year than speeding, drunk driving, and other major accident causes. 240. In the United States, more than 6 million vehicle accidents happen every year, and the number continues to rise. The National Highway Traffic Safety Administration reports that about 10% of all fatal accidents throughout the nation involve a distracted driver. . 6. These accidents injure about 3 million people per year.
